K12 INC. TO VOLUNTARILY DELIST FROM NYSE ARCA
Trading Began on the NYSE Today
Herndon, VA, December 31, 2008 — K12 Inc. (NYSE: LRN), a leading provider of proprietary, technology-based curriculum and education services created for online delivery to students in kindergarten through 12th grade, announced that it has voluntarily delisted its common stock from NYSE Arca. The Company determined that it was in the best interests of the Company and its stockholders to withdraw its listing from NYSE Arca in light of the Company’s acceptance for listing on the New York Stock Exchange.
About K12
K12 Inc. (NYSE: LRN) is a leading provider of proprietary, technology-based curriculum and online education programs to students in grades K-12. K12 provides its curriculum and academic services to online schools, traditional classrooms, blended school programs, and directly to families. Over 50,000 students in 21 states are enrolled in online public schools using the K12 program. K12 Inc. also operates the K12 International Academy, an accredited, diploma-granting online private school serving students worldwide.
K12’s mission is to provide any child the curriculum and tools to maximize success in life, regardless of geographic, financial, or demographic circumstances. K12 Inc. is accredited through the Commission on International and Trans-Regional Accreditation (CITA). It is the largest national K-12 online school provider to be recognized by CITA.
